Rad sequence diagram software

Symbol and components of a uml sequence diagram uml sequence diagrams. Rad examples school of computer science and software. Stacks was developed to work with restriction enzymebased data, such as rad seq, for the purpose of building genetic maps and conducting population genomics and phylogeography. The ultimate guide to sequence diagrams in uml includes a general overview, benefits and scenarios, basic symbols and components, examples, and more. An important aspect of rad markers and mapping is the process of isolating rad. Browse sequence diagram templates and examples you can make with smartdraw. Sequence diagram software free download sequence diagram top 4 download offers free software downloads for windows, mac, ios and android computers and mobile devices. The above sequence diagram depicts the sequence diagram for. Study 62 terms systems analysis quiz 4 flashcards quizlet. In software engineering a sequence diagram that shows, for a particular scenario of a use case, the events that external actors generate, their order, and possible intersystem events. The objects involved in the method are listed from left to right according to when they take part in the message sequence. Uml sequence diagram symbol and components of sequence diagram. Create professional flowcharts, process maps, uml models, org charts, and er diagrams using our templates. Restriction site associated dna sequencing rad seq is a method to identify and score rad markers, a type of polymorphic genetic marker that are used for population genetic studies, particularly for species with limited existing sequence data.

The free uml tool umlet lets you draw uml diagrams with a lightweight, popupfree user interface. The reason the sequence diagram is so useful is because it shows the interaction. Restriction site associated dna sequencing rad sequencing is the method that involves cutting a genome with at least one restriction enzyme and sequencing the ends of the resulting fragments on a nextgeneration sequencer preferably on an illumina sequencer. The above sequence diagram depicts the sequence diagram for an emotion based music player. This methodology improves the quality of the software project and over all process of software. This article is for software architects, designers, and developers who want to use ibm rational software architect to reverse engineer uml class and sequence diagrams from java source code. Rapid application model or rad model is one of the software development models which is in practice highly. Text to uml tools fastest way to create your models. Quick sequence diagram editor might suit your needs. Uml diagram knowledge different uml diagrams purpose and usage posted by allison lynch 04102020 here is a simple introduction on different types of uml diagrams, including class, activity, component, collaboration, sequence, use case, deployment,statechart and package diagrams.

As long as you are interested in drawing class diagrams, sequence diagrams or use case diagrams youll find several options. It allows for evaluation but in order for it to be continuously used, it needs to be purchased. Creately diagrams can be exported and added to word, ppt powerpoint, excel, visio or any other document. They arent so often used in business process modelling. You can edit this template and create your own diagram. You can use it as a flowchart maker, network diagram software, to create uml online, as an er diagram tool, to design database schema, to build bpmn online, as a circuit diagram.

Uml, tools eclipse plugins, bundles and products eclipse. From the package explorer view, expand the zipcode class. The canonical case is a uml sequence diagram where the notation comes from, which represents the messages exchanged between objects in a software system. These diagrams are used by software developers and business professionals to understand requirements for a new system or to document an existing process. Aug 27, 2018 in this stepbystep tutorial, well show you how to make a uml sequence diagram using lucidchart. Introduction to software development life cycle sdlc.

Use the uml shape library and sequence diagram templates provided when you start a free account in lucidchart. Improve documentation and help your team communicate faster. Tools, templates and resources to draw sequence diagrams. Sequence diagrams are used mostly by software developers to notedown and understand the requirements of new and preexisting systems. As you can guess from its name, the sequence diagram shows the order in which interactions take place. Uml sequence diagram symbol and components of sequence. Stepbystep guide on how to draw a sequence diagram in uml using lucidchart. Use a static structure diagram in visio to create class diagrams that decompose a software system into its parts. Software engineering entityrelationship diagram javatpoint.

An important aspect of rad markers and mapping is the process of isolating rad tags, which are the dna sequences that immediately flank each instance of a particular restriction site of a restriction enzyme throughout the genome. The thing i like about it is that the diagrams are specified using text files, which makes me happy since i dont. Lucidchart is your solution for visual communication and crossplatform collaboration. Restriction site associated dna rad markers are a type of genetic marker which are useful for association mapping, qtlmapping, population genetics, ecological genetics and evolution. Car rental system sequence diagram to visualize the messages passed through different entities in your car rental diagram. This document describes how to specify sequence diagram modelers with sirius. Use this guide and create your own sequence diagram in uml for free with lucidchart. For me, papyrus which is an eclipse plugin is one the best, it follows the. The developments are time boxed, delivered and then assembled into a working prototype. The sequence diagram captures the time sequence of the message flow from one object to another and the collaboration diagram describes the organization of objects in a system taking part in the message flow. In the diagram or model view, locate the desired class and select the method. I am trying to use rad for our school project and i was searching for a model diagram to follow but i found 2. See why smartdraw is the smartest way to draw any type of chart, diagram. Sequence diagrams play a key role in documentation.

Use pdf export for high quality prints and svg export for large sharp images or embed your diagrams. An ssd shows for one particular scenario of a use case the events that external actors generate, their order, and intersystem events the system is treated as a blackbox ssds are derived from use cases. The authors explain limitations of reverse engineering with rational software architect and describe techniques to overcome them. Today, when it comes to support for uml, rad studio is making key technologies available.

The most important consequence of this is that contrary to what happens on a classical diagram, the relative graphical positions of elements on a sequence diagram have strong meaning. The thing i like about it is that the diagrams are specified using text files, which makes me happy since i dont like the pure visual approach used by the visio and rational tools. Software tools are used for data preprocessing and processing, duplicate read removal, genome assembly, snp detection, and phylogenetic inference. Unified modelling language uml is a modeling language in the field of software engineering which aims to set standard ways to visualize the design of a system. Rad editable uml activity diagram template on creately. This topic provides instructions for generating sequence diagrams for your source code. The use of rad markers for genetic mapping is often called rad mapping. Visualize with rational application developer a tour of rational application developers visual diagramming tools skill level. Class diagrams sequence diagrams browse diagrams topic diagrams note.

Use a sequence diagram to show the actors or objects participating in an interaction and the events they generate arranged in a time sequence. In the model explorer tree view, rightclick the package in which you want to include the static structure diagram, point to new, and click sequence diagram. Bioinformatics tools for radseq analysis omicx omictools. These diagrams are used by software developers and business. A sequence diagram is one such type of diagram that can be designed with uml. Umlet runs standalone or as eclipse plugin on windows, os x and linux. Anyone from software developers to business people who are trying to create models that will show how and in what order objects work together by using a sequence diagram. Overview rapid application development is a model that represents one method as to how software can be developed.

Status or the state of something is often a key partof the logic within many systems and processes. One is the sequence diagram and the other is the collaboration diagram. If status and timing are critical components of a solution,then state and sequence diagramswill boost the value of your requirements. When i create a synchronous message, it automatically creates the dotted line, but i also need it to generate a sequence diagram editor might suit your needs. Draw a sequence diagram quickly using our drag and drop diagram editor show case interactions design. Uml sequence diagrams are the first highly detailed behavioural diagrams that you will create when using uml for software development. Uml sequence diagrams sequence diagram is an interaction diagram that shows the objects participating in a particular interaction and the messages they exchange arranged in a time sequence. In rad model the components or functions are developed in parallel as if they were mini projects. Software engineer ibm 07 feb 2006 rational application developer provides visual diagramming tools to help you gain. Stacks is a software pipeline for building loci from shortread sequences, such as those generated on the illumina platform. A sequence diagram shows the sequence in time of messages, which are exchanged among roles that implement the behavior of the system. Visual paradigm offers a pretty good free tool to draw not only sequence diagrams but also all uml 2.

Have a look at umlet, a free uml tool for fast uml diagrams. Radseq combines restriction enzymes and molecular identifiers to associate sequence reads to particular individuals. Reverse engineering uml class and sequence diagrams from java. Sequence diagram software free download sequence diagram.

I am trying to create several sequence diagrams in rad, and i have two questions. Diagrams that show message sequence and or interaction between objects and the sequences of messages. For sequence diagrams, umlgraph uses a different approach and this is one aspect i dont like about the tool, you are. You can use the sequence diagrams to describe message exchanges within your project. The mechanic will also need a similar computer and card reader in the garage. Rad seq combines restriction enzymes and molecular identifiers to associate sequence reads to particular individuals. As the consumer explicitly listens for events from the queue, i would start the diagram. Under template categories, click software and database, and then click uml model diagram.

Founded in 2014 with the purpose to improve the efficiency when creating and working with sequence diagrams by. Which is a good free software to make sequence diagram. Rad model is typically an incremental model where multiple developments of small small. Paid versions allow you to run a private version of the software. Uml sequence diagrams, free examples and software download. A method for population genomics 20 million reads per lane 8 lanes per run 32 gb per run 100 base pairs per read 4 gb per lane illumina gaiix sequencing machine hiseq 2000 will be. Sequence diagrams are a type of unified modeling language uml diagram that shows.

Software engineering entityrelationship diagram with software engineering tutorial, models, engineering, software development life cycle, sdlc, requirement engineering, waterfall model, spiral model, rapid application development model, rad, software management, etc. Development of components are time boxed, delivered, and then assembled into working prototype. Group uml sequence diagrams by use cases to effectively represent users requirements. The sequence diagram is a good diagram to use to document a systems requirements and to flush out a systems design. Help your developers and product people understand each other better. Software will be needed to interface with the card reader. A method for population genomics john davey illumina sequencing seminar edinburgh 1 july 2010 institute of evolutionary biology university of edinburgh john. Rational application developer can be used to diagram more than just java classes in class diagrams. Sequence diagram tool with all sequence diagram objects, sequence diagram templates etc. Sequence diagrams are a type of unified modeling language uml diagram that shows interactions.

In ddrad you use two different enzymes thereby two different adapters and know that some with sequence and some with not. Introduction to rapid application development rad 1. Introductions rad refers to a development life cycle designed to give much faster development and higher quality systems than the traditional life cycle. Use pdf export for high quality prints and svg export for large sharp images or embed your diagrams anywhere with the creately viewer. This feature is available for implementation projects only. As the queue is an important component in the sequence you are presenting, it should most definitely be present with a lifeline. Smartdraw create flowcharts, floor plans, and other diagrams. Sequence diagrams are used mostly by software developers to notedown and.

A uml use case diagram showing use case diagram for rad tool. Sequence diagram is an interaction diagram that details how operations are carried out what messages are sent and when. Unified modeling language uml sequence diagrams in this post we discuss sequence diagrams. System sequence diagram a system sequence diagram ssd illustrates input and output events. The gene sequence coding for gfp was first isolated from the marine jellyfish aequorea victoria and has since been widely used in cellular and molecular biology as a reporter to detect gene expression in transgenic organisms. Jul 29, 2016 in software engineering a sequence diagram that shows, for a particular scenario of a use case, the events that external actors generate, their order, and possible intersystem events. These diagrams easily depict the flow, interaction among objects, and message. Software engineering entityrelationship diagram with software engineering tutorial, models, engineering, software development life cycle, sdlc, requirement engineering, waterfall model, spiral model, rapid application development model, rad, software. Rad model stands for rapid application development model is a parallel development of functions and subsequent integration, where each component or function is developed in parallel as if they were mini projects. Software tools are used for data preprocessing and processing, duplicate read.

Rad model is typically an incremental model where multiple developments of small small chunks are picked and developed simultaneously to achieve the bigger picture. For sequence diagrams, umlgraph uses a different approach and this is one aspect i dont like about the tool, you. The diagram is used to depict the interaction between several objects in a system. Founded in 2014 with the purpose to improve the efficiency when creating and working with sequence diagrams by combining text notation scripting and drawing by clicking and dragging in the same model.

This section of the tutorial guides you through the process of creating a sequence diagram using rational application developer. This tutorial will help you plan and create a sequence diagram using standard practices. You can place messages in a sequence diagram as part of developing the software. A sequence diagram tool free download can be used for this purpose to create the interaction diagrams in an interactive way.

Communication diagrams are another way to visualize the information more commonly represented by uml sequence diagrams. A sequence diagram is a type of interaction diagram because it describes howand in what ordera group of objects works together. They are simpler than sequence diagrams and only show the messages that pass between the objects or roles in a software. The reason the sequence diagram is so useful is because it shows the interaction logic between the objects in the system in the time order that the interactions take place.

Other rad applications are double digest rad ddrad and 2brad. A sequence diagram for an emotion based music player figure a sequence diagram for an emotion based music player. Create editable sequence diagram with rational software architect. Many businessmen also use these diagrams to understand and establish systems too. Time in a sequence diagram is all a about ordering, not duration.

Create sequence diagrams online sequence diagram tool. Generating sequence diagrams rad studio embarcadero docwiki. This software can be used for different uml diagrams like component, deployment, composite structure, sequence, statechart, communication, profile diagrams, activity, usecase, class as well as object. Green fluorescent protein gfp is a protein that glows with a bright green fluorescence when exposed to ultraviolet light. Now that a uml class diagram has been created, you are going to utilize another visualization capability that rational application developer offers. What is rad model advantages, disadvantages and when to use it. Edraw is ideal for software designers and software developers who need to draw uml sequence diagrams.

193 1468 1201 1443 903 77 239 441 8 1559 996 1512 267 192 793 490 812 257 938 1448 62 12 1296 1455 1140 1496 1615 266 1412 1370 770 1496 208 1590 1168 384 1217 1450 215 731 492 1220 452